Re-introduction into the market! - Double disc in a slipcase with CD re-master and three extra tracks from the original sessions, 6-page leporello booklet including linernotes by Rob Kenner. The second disc is the 100 minute DVD with the Sizzla live in Miami (2004 in 5.1), two music videos including "Thank U Mamma" and exclusive interviews for MTV and BBC1. Originally released in 2002, the Bobby "Digital-B" Dixon produced album was voted internationally as Best Reggae Album Of 2003 and appears for most of the fans to be the best Sizzla album ever. The finest available musicians at that time helped realise this masterpiece. Riddims include classics of the jamaican music history like Rocking Time, Cuss Cuss, Far East, Java, Fade Away, Queen Majesty and a selection of Digital B exclusives. Note: The song "Solid As A Rock" was sampled by Jay Z for the 2013 album "Magna Carta... Holy Crail" for the track "Crown", the song "Woman I Need You" is on the same riddim as Gentleman's renown song "Dem Gone". Musicians: Kirk Bennet (Drums), Donald "Danny Bassie" Dennis (Bass), Paul "Wrong Move" Crossdale (Keyboards), Ian "Beezy" Coleman (Guitar), David Anglin (Percussion), Mark Darson (Drums), Dalton Brownie (Guitars), Dean "Cannon" Fraser (Horns), Robbie Shakespeare (Bass), Robbie Lyn (Keyboards), Errol Hird (Horns), Sly Dunbar (Percussion, Funde Drums), Melborne 'Dusty' Miller (Drums), Maroghini (Percussion), Bradley Brown (Drums), Paul "Computer Paul" Henton (Keyboards), Willburn "Squidley" Cole (Drums), Chris Meredith (Bass), Nambo Robinson (Horns), Leroy "Mafia" Heywood (Drums), Benji Myaz (Bass, Keyboards, Guitar).
